Birmingham City 0 Rotherham United 2: We controlled the game from first minute, insists Evans
Derbyshire was on the mark in the first half and the victory was sealed in the second period when Tony Andreu, on loan from Norwich, hammered in fine goal to give the Millers their second successive win to take them off the bottom of the table.
Boss Steve Evans said: “We set the tone in the first minute and it was all about us. We controlled the game from start to finish.
